Unlike brush-type DC motors, a brushless permanent magnet DC motor has an impedance which is resistive at low rotational speeds and becomes increasingly inductive at higher speeds. Consequently, a control for a brushless permanent magnet DC motor must control both supply voltage and commutation angle in order to maximize motor performance. The simultaneous control of both supply voltage and commutation angle is difficult to achieve and requires complex circuitry. The present invention overcomes this problem by providing first means for developing a motor performance command signal representing a desired motor operational characteristics, second means for developing a motor feedback signal representing an actual motor operational characteristic, and means coupled to the first and second developing means for deriving the commutation angle command signal and the voltage command signal from the motor performance command signal and the motor feedback signal so that the motor operates with the desired operational characteristic.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ION In accordance with the present invention, a control for a brushless DC motor according to the present invention permits a brushless DC motor to be operated in a simple fashion according to a desired operational characteristic.
Broadly, there is disclosed herein a control for a brushless DC motor that includes a permanent magnet rotor and a stator having stator coils which are energized in accordance with a commutation angle command signal and a voltage command signal for imparting rotation to the rotor.
The control comprises first means for developing a motor performance command signal representing a desired operational characteristic of the motor, second means for developing a motor feedback signal representing an actual operational characterictis of the motor and means coupled to the first and second developing means for deriving the commutation angle command signal and the voltage command signal from the motor performance command signal and the motor feedback signal so that the motor exhibits the desired operational characteristic.
Specifically, in the preferred embodiment of the invention, the motor control includes a motor system controller coupled to a motor electronic control circuit.
The motor system controller develops a motor performance command signal in response to an input command signal and a feedback signal from the motor.
The motor performance command signal may represent, for example, a command for constant torque or a command for torque as a function of motor speed.
The function generator is responsive to the motor performance command signal and the motor feedback signal and develops both a commutation angle command signal and a voltage command signal therefrom.
The commutation angle command signal and the voltage command signal are utilized by the motor electronic control circuit to drive the motor in the commanded fashion.
The function generator is implemented either by software in a microprocessor or by hardware.
In the peferred embodiment, the function generator utilizes mathematical models of the motor operation which correlate voltage and commutation angle commands with torque commands as a function of motor speed
